About

Evan S. Tanenbaum is a corporate and incorporation attorney with more than 35 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Offices of Evan S. Tanenbaum in Port Jefferson, NY. He attended Syracuse University College of Law and earned a degree from Lehigh University BA in 1986. He has been admitted to the New York Bar since 1991. His practice encompasses corporate and incorporation, criminal defense, nursing home abuse and neglect, and real estate,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
